Taxonomic Classification

Rank Amazon Dwarf Squirrel Bat Laurel
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Rosales (Roses & Allies)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Rosaceae (Rose Family)
Genus Microsciurus Prunus (Cherries & Plums)
Species Microsciurus flaviventer Prunus polystachya
